Antique Wilkinson Leaded glass lamp! You can certainly see the competition with Duffner in this shade! Dohr gold leading in and out. One fracture see last pics. !! Shade 18″ at widest point 8″ deep. Normal wilkinson lock cap aperture. Base is copper plated with just the right antique wear to look great! 3 pull chain sockets Meteor with acorn pulls. Was re-wired at some point with in line switch added. It just sparkles with a overall rich look! The base is heavy and tall. Shade is in great shape. Thanks for your view enjoy! Antique Bradley and Hubbard Slag Glass Lamp. Has a patent date of October 20th 1908 inside the lamp shade. Marked Bradley & Hubbard MFG. CO and 2112 on the base bottom. Excellent condition, I can’t find any flaws that stand out. The pull chain turns on one bulb, then another pull turns both bulbs on. Yet another pull turns the opposite bulb on only and the final pull turns both bulbs off again. Stands approximately 21.5 inches high and 15 inches wide. The huge base is finely cast spelter with a gorgeous design, and the shade has a grapevine growing along the bottom. It has it`s original glass with no damage. A truly magnificent lamp! It has 2 ball pull chain sockets and has been re-wired with cloth covered cord. It is unsigned and probably had a maker sticker on it that is long gone. I have never seen this hanger before and probably never will again lol. It has great glass folks and is in excellent overall original condition. It measures 25inches wide and is 14 inches tall. There is no missing segments of glass and the leading is all tight and right throughout. This is a very heavy hanging shade and extremely well built. It has its original socket cluster with matching Webber turnkey sockets. There’s no broken areas of glass and just a stray heat crack here or there, 1-2 and as to be expected for a shade this size. This is unsigned but 100% guaranteed to be Bradley and Hubbard. How do I know? Glass color, design, shape, and hardware. Every maker has certain attributes that identify them regardless if they are signed or not. Just like a painting that’s not signed but art dealers/experts know who it is anyways.
